Output 8ba58eb5c116ef9e59ce51d6e5eaa7fdcdee9c959a93bb8f37fb5b2bccfeb122:1

value
1977941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666c0d0f27a91b182cdf59ee15ee627e2b333ce6 OP_EQUAL
address
3B2aHdHXoDrhMB5paggSH2xWiaJiWg2Zgv
transaction
8ba58eb5c116ef9e59ce51d6e5eaa7fdcdee9c959a93bb8f37fb5b2bccfeb122
spent
true